Hair Texture

The texture of one's hair plays a significant role in the formation and growth rate of dreadlocks. Coarse or curly hair tends to lock more easily compared to straight or fine hair. This is primarily due to the natural structure and characteristics of coarse and curly hair.

Coarse hair, characterized by a thicker diameter and a rougher texture, has a greater tendency to tangle and interlock. The rougher texture creates more friction between hair strands, facilitating the locking process. Curly hair, with its inherent coils and bends, also contributes to the formation of dreadlocks. The natural curvature of curly hair allows it to loop and intertwine with neighboring strands, leading to the development of knots and locks.

The ease with which coarse or curly hair locks translates into faster growth. Once dreadlocks are formed, the interlocking strands effectively trap hair within the lock. This prevents the hair from growing out as it would in loose hair, resulting in increased length and thickness of the dreadlocks over time.

Understanding the connection between hair texture and dreadlock growth is important for individuals considering dreadlocks and for those who already have them. For those with coarse or curly hair, the knowledge of faster growth can influence their decision to embrace dreadlocks and provide realistic expectations about the growth rate.

Washing Frequency

Washing dreadlocks less often is an important aspect of maintaining their health and promoting growth. Dreadlocks, by nature, tend to be drier than loose hair due to their tightly packed structure. Washing them too frequently can strip away their natural oils, leaving them dry, brittle, and prone to breakage. This can hinder growth and lead to stunted or damaged dreadlocks.

Preserving the natural oils in dreadlocks is crucial for nourishing hair and stimulating growth. These oils provide essential nutrients and moisture to the hair follicles, promoting healthy hair growth. When dreadlocks are washed less often, the natural oils have more time to accumulate and penetrate the hair shaft, creating a nourishing environment for growth.

In addition to preserving natural oils, washing dreadlocks less often also reduces manipulation and stress on the hair. Excessive washing and handling can cause friction and breakage, damaging the delicate structure of dreadlocks. By washing them less frequently, you minimize these risks and allow dreadlocks to grow stronger and healthier.
